Episode 48: Live from Arendal - New AI Genres with Zahra Rizvi, Hanna Lauvli and Jason Nelson.

Recorded live at from the AI tent at Arendal, Wednesday, 12 August 2026.

Scott Rettberg hosts a live panel from Arendalsuka featuring Center for Digital Narrative researchers Zahra Rizvi, Hanna Lauvli and Jason Nelson. The panel explores how generative AI is reshaping narrative practices, ranging from sensor-driven digital art and "AI slop" meme culture to intimate relationships with AI companions on Reddit. Together, they debate the tensions between de-skilling and democratization, the geopolitical and climate costs of big tech, and how creators are critically pushing back against algorithmic homogenization.


AI Boyfriends as New Romantic Texts – Zahra Rizvi
Algorithmic intimacy and the pursuit of romantic companionship are creating new narratives and creative possibilities. This research provides insight into the Reddit discussion forum AI Boyfriends, and the stories that emerge where romance meets AI.

Millions of data points become a story – Jason Nelson
Imagine turning tens of millions of data points into an ever-changing story. Intelligent systems can turn what was previously near impossible into new forms of digital storytelling.

The Artist’s Negotiation with AI – Hanna Lauvli
In the art world, artists express fear and doubt about the vast amounts of stolen data that AI is built on, how it will affect their job market, and the very basis of what creativity is. This research looks at how content creators and artists negotiate their own relationships with generative AI online.
